Pine is a kids' syndicated show from Canada, probably the 40s, but I'm not positive. If you have 11 episodes, you've got 'em all.
Blair is a bit of a mystery and I've been working on this one a while. It could be American, Canadian or British in origin. It was produced between WW I and WW II, probably mid-30s. There are 28 episodes in circulation, most are complete stories in 15 minutes, but a few are two-parters. Jack French Editor: RADIO RECALL |

| ADDRESS UNKOWN, I believe, is one of the South African shows that showed up many years ago. From what I have been told, George Jennings went over there with the idea of syndicating the shows over here. Nothing came of it, but he did bring about 19 reels of the shows back over here. Those are the ones that have been floating around for years. I have dates on some, but not all of them. The shows that I do have dated are from 1969. Hope this helps. Ted |
